Smartphone SIM vs. Digital SIM: What's the Distinction?

For years , your mobile device needed a physical subscriber identity module to utilize your copyright's services. This tiny plastic component slid into a compartment. However, a new system has arisen : the embedded SIM . Unlike its physical predecessor , an eSIM is a component directly integrated into your gadget. This allows you to install network configurations wirelessly, often doing away with the requirement for a removable subscriber identity module . Ultimately, the main contrast is that one is removable while the other is virtual.

Smartphone Data: SIM, eSIM, and Wireless Explained

Understanding how your gadget accesses data can feel complex, especially with the evolution of different systems. Traditionally, mobile phones relied on a Physical SIM (Subscriber Identity Module) – a removable card that identifies you to your service. However, the rise of eSIM (embedded SIM) offers a different approach, where the SIM is embedded directly into the handset's hardware, removing the need for a tangible card. Beyond SIMs (both physical and embedded), your device also utilizes wireless connectivity – encompassing technologies like Wi-Fi and cellular networks - to actually send the content you're consuming. Here's a brief breakdown:

  • SIM: A physical card.
  • eSIM: An integrated SIM.
  • Wireless: Connectivity via Wi-Fi and cellular radios.
